Hadith of Abdullah bin Zaid bin Asim al-Mazini (RA), who was a companion.

حديث عبد الله بن زيد بن عاصم المازني (1) وكانت له صحبة

Hadith 329:9

'Abd al-Razzaq narrated to us, he said: Malik informed us, from 'Amr ibn Yahya, from his father, from 'Abdullah ibn Zayd: "That the Prophet, peace and blessings of Allah be upon him, wiped his head with his two hands, moving them forward and backward. He began with the front of his head, then took them to the back of his head, then returned them until he reached the place from which he began."

حدثنا عبد الرزاق، قال: أخبرنا مالك، عن عمرو بن يحيى، عن أبيه، عن عبد الله بن زيد، " أن النبي صلى الله عليه وسلم مسح رأسه بيديه فأقبل بهما وأدبر، وبدأ بمقدم رأسه ثم ذهب بهما إلى قفاه، ثم ردهما حتى رجع إلى المكان الذي بدأ منه "
